Shasta Lake RV Resort and Campground has 7½ acres of pine, poplar, and pear trees. Hot showers, play area, horseshoes. Secluded tent sites have BBQs, fire rings and tables. Private boat dock. (800) 3SH-ASTA

Sierra Springs Trailer Resort includes amenities such as WiFi, water, sewer, electricity. This pet friendly campground is located on 70099 California Highway 70 in Portola, CA. Table Tennis, basketball, and volleyball are some of the activities you can enjoy during your stay here.

Located on 102 Little Road in Blairsden, CA lies the Little Bear RV Park. This pet friendly RV park includes WiFi, water, sewer, showers, electricity. You can also enjoy activities such as Golf, hiking, and scenic drives during your stay.
